This is a real julep, the now classic julep first served to Derby guests in 1875 by Col Meriwether Lewis Clark Jr., the founder of Churchill Downs Now, as then, it is made with just four ingredients: finely crushed ice, a little sugar water, fresh spearmint and fine, aged, 90-proof straight Kentucky bourbon.
